We have a small little new guy and he cannot make it all night either. Even with as you said the food and before bed potty. His cage is as directed and he just can't make it. So my smart husband found a box to attach to one end and lined it with a pee pad. JJ has done great since then (4 nights) plus on days we are at work he goes into the box. It at least teaches him to go on the pee pad which is not his balnkets or carpet, he doesn't have to lay near it, and we get some sleep.
We have the kennel that open in the front and end. He opened the end and then used plastic ties to put through the box and kennel. The way he placed the box was so that it only opens to the kennel and then is all enclosed so that JJ can't jump out of it.
I hope it helps. We did the same thing with our 11 mo. old Cosmo and he is now completly potty trained.
Good luck, is a long process so don't get disappointed. Cosmo took all 11 months to "get it."
